PHILLIP ELBLING Obituary

Phillip Elbling, beloved husband and best friend of Lois; loving father of Frank Elbling (Gerald Kass) and Alayne (David) Howard; proud "Bop" of Sam and Mikey; cherished brother-in-law of Howard Pearlman; fond uncle of many. Services Wednesday, 10 a.m., at Chicago Jewish Funerals Chapel, 195 N. Buffalo Grove Rd., (1 block N. of Lake Cook), Buffalo Grove. Interment Memorial Gardens Cemetery, Kankakee, IL.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to Make-A-Wish Foundation, 640 N. LaSalle St. #280, Chicago, IL 60654, www.wishes.org. A mensh through and through, Phil lived to fulfill his most precious dreams. Together with Lois, he built a loving family. Despite many obstacles, Phil became an accomplished scientist applying computer technology to the steel industry and other areas as well long before there was a Silicon Valley. After his retirement from IBM he studied at the Art Institute and became an artist who created paintings that were unique in their blending of color and shapes.. You will be missed, dear friend.
